Q; How fast is the hiring process at Coins.ph?
A: We balance efficiency with our commitment to excellence. As a regulated institution, we have rigorous standards to ensure we bring on the right talent who share our values of integrity and high performance. However, we’ve streamlined this process to respect your time. While it typically takes 10 to 15 days, for key talents who align with our vision, we can expedite the journey from application to offer in as little as one week.

Q: What are your current employee retention and regularization rates? What are the reasons why employees stay?
A: Stability is one of Coins.ph’s greatest strengths. Our employees typically stay for at least one year, and our regularization rate remains consistently around 80%, demonstrating our strong commitment to developing and investing in our probationary employees for the long term. We’re really focused on helping our people grow and stay engaged. From what we’ve seen, people stay at Coins.ph for three main reasons: growth, compensation, and culture.
For growth, Coins.ph offers accelerated career paths at the intersection of fintech and crypto. Many of our current leaders, and even senior managers, were promoted internally, which shows that we reward performance, potential, and the desire to grow.
In terms of compensation, we maintain a highly competitive compensation strategy, with packages consistently positioned above industry averages.
Lastly, the culture. Employees feel valued in an inclusive, collaborative, and flexible environment that supports both professional development and personal well-being.

Q: How does Coins.ph promote work-life balance?
A: We value talents and prioritize empowering our employees to achieve balance, starting with a supportive and flexible structure. We offer a Hybrid Work Setup with Flexi Time. We require our employees to report to the office three days a week with Tuesdays and Wednesdays as required days for coordination and collaboration, giving employees control over where and when they are most productive. We also don’t follow a strict 9-6 schedule. We also protect personal time with very generous leave credits and unique time-off options like Birthday Leave. Finally, we actively invest in wellness through company-sponsored social and fitness clubs, making sure we foster a culture where disconnecting is just as important as working hard.
